diff --git a/src/app/modals/view-media/view-media.page.html b/src/app/modals/view-media/view-media.page.html index 63ccfcd8c..d34bc1d4d 100644 --- a/src/app/modals/view-media/view-media.page.html +++ b/src/app/modals/view-media/view-media.page.html @@ -14,28 +14,32 @@ -
+
-
-
+
+
- - - - +
+ +
+
- + + +
+ +
+
+
+ + + \ No newline at end of file diff --git a/src/app/modals/view-media/view-media.page.ts b/src/app/modals/view-media/view-media.page.ts index 66e49deca..b65c4f58c 100644 --- a/src/app/modals/view-media/view-media.page.ts +++ b/src/app/modals/view-media/view-media.page.ts @@ -1,5 +1,5 @@ import { Component, OnInit } from '@angular/core'; -import { ModalController, NavParams } from '@ionic/angular'; +import { ModalController, NavParams, Platform } from '@ionic/angular'; import { DomSanitizer} from '@angular/platform-browser'; import { pdfDefaultOptions } from 'ngx-extended-pdf-viewer'; @@ -14,10 +14,10 @@ export class ViewMediaPage implements OnInit { type: any; name: string _updatedAt: string + view: boolean sliderOpts = { - zoom: true, - maxRation: 2 + zoom: true }; base64Sanitize:any = ""; @@ -26,6 +26,7 @@ export class ViewMediaPage implements OnInit { private modalController: ModalController, private navParams:NavParams, public sanitizer: DomSanitizer, + private platform: Platform, ) { this.image = this.navParams.get('image') @@ -38,6 +39,12 @@ export class ViewMediaPage implements OnInit { ngOnInit() { this.base64Sanitize = this.sanitizer.bypassSecurityTrustResourceUrl(this.image); + + if (this.platform.is('desktop')) { + this.view = true; + } else { + this.view = false; + } } @@ -60,10 +67,6 @@ export class ViewMediaPage implements OnInit { const blob = new Blob(byteArrays, { type: contentType }); return blob; }; - - - - close(){ this.modalController.dismiss()